For many students, obesity is more than a societal problem; it’s something they wear like a badge of shame. Being told that they are flawed, for something they can not immediately change, can cause high levels of stress. If we want to instill a lifelong passion for wellness, we must teach them to replace their unhealthy coping skills with healthy ones, by putting the focus on food, fitness and fun, not fear.
